Mercurial > hg
comparison tests/test-help.t @ 44295:142d2a4cb69a
help: add a mechanism to change flags' help depending on config
It seems reasonable to have a similar mechanism for the rest of the
help, but no such thing is implemented.
The goal is to make the help of commands clearer in the presence of
significant default changes, like tweakdefaults or with company-wide
hgrcs. In these cases, a user looking at the help of a command doesn't
exactly know what his hgrc is doing.
Apply to this to the --git option of commands that display diffs, as
this option in particular causes confusion for some reason.
Differential Revision: https://phab.mercurial-scm.org/D8100
author | Valentin Gatien-Baron <valentin.gatienbaron@gmail.com> |
---|---|
date | Sun, 09 Feb 2020 15:50:36 -0500 |
parents | d8b53385b1bc |
children | c577bb4a04d4 |
comparison
equal
deleted
inserted
replaced
44294:234001d22ba6 | 44295:142d2a4cb69a |
---|---|
785 | 785 |
786 rebase command to move sets of revisions to a different ancestor | 786 rebase command to move sets of revisions to a different ancestor |
787 | 787 |
788 (use 'hg help extensions' for information on enabling extensions) | 788 (use 'hg help extensions' for information on enabling extensions) |
789 [255] | 789 [255] |
790 | |
791 Checking that help adapts based on the config: | |
792 | |
793 $ hg help diff --config ui.tweakdefaults=true | egrep -e '^ *(-g|config)' | |
794 -g --[no-]git use git extended diff format (default: on from | |
795 config) | |
790 | 796 |
791 Make sure that we don't run afoul of the help system thinking that | 797 Make sure that we don't run afoul of the help system thinking that |
792 this is a section and erroring out weirdly. | 798 this is a section and erroring out weirdly. |
793 | 799 |
794 $ hg .log | 800 $ hg .log |